Dear Matt, Dear Petsc
After my recent pull of petsc master I encounter test fails that use
dmplex meshes.
I attached a simple script to show an issue where DMPlexRestoreCone
mangles the cone relationships in the DM.
The behaviour happens with gcc 7.4.0 aswell as icc 19.0.3.199
@ current petsc/master d3dc048301fdb3e4c282b528e7b28910551cfe13
We recently had a system update and I am not 100% sure if this is some
weird stuff going on at my end or if this is indeed Plex related or if I
should not call Restore in the inner loop.
Anyway, I would be most grateful if you could try to reproduce the error
and hint me towards a solution.
As always, many many thanks!
Fabian

program main
#include "petsc/finclude/petsc.h"
use petsc
implicit none
PetscErrorCode :: ierr
PetscInt :: i
DM :: dm
call PetscInitialize(PETSC_NULL_CHARACTER,ierr)
call create_plex()
call PetscObjectViewFromOptions(dm, PETSC_NULL_VEC, "-show_plex", ierr)
call print_cones()
call PetscObjectViewFromOptions(dm, PETSC_NULL_VEC, "-show_plex", ierr)
call DMDestroy(dm, ierr)
call PetscFinalize(ierr)
contains
subroutine print_cones()
PetscInt :: pstart, pEnd
PetscInt, pointer :: cone(:)
call DMPlexGetChart(dm, pStart, pEnd, ierr); CHKERRQ(ierr)
do i = pStart, pEnd-1
call DMPlexGetCone(dm, i, cone, ierr); CHKERRQ(ierr)
print *,'Cone',i,':',cone
! Next line is troublesome because it mangles the DM
call DMPlexRestoreCone(dm, i, cone, ierr); CHKERRQ(ierr)
enddo
end subroutine
subroutine create_plex()
call DMPlexCreate(PETSC_COMM_WORLD, dm, ierr);CHKERRQ(ierr)
call PetscObjectSetName(dm, 'testplex', ierr);CHKERRQ(ierr)
call DMSetDimension(dm, 3, ierr);CHKERRQ(ierr)
call DMPlexSetChart(dm, 0, 21, ierr); CHKERRQ(ierr)
! Preallocation
! cell has 5 faces
call DMPlexSetConeSize(dm, 0, 5, ierr); CHKERRQ(ierr)
! Faces have 3 or 4 edges
do i=1,2
call DMPlexSetConeSize(dm, i, 3, ierr); CHKERRQ(ierr)
enddo
do i=3,5
call DMPlexSetConeSize(dm, i, 4, ierr); CHKERRQ(ierr)
enddo
! Edges have 2 vertices
do i=6,14
call DMPlexSetConeSize(dm, i, 2, ierr); CHKERRQ(ierr)
enddo
call DMSetUp(dm, ierr); CHKERRQ(ierr) ! Allocate space for cones
! Setup Connections
! 0 cell has faces 1(bottom) and 2(top) as well as three faces on sides
call DMPlexSetCone(dm, 0, [1,2,3,4,5], ierr); CHKERRQ(ierr)
! bottom face has 3 edges
call DMPlexSetCone(dm, 1, [ 6, 7, 8], ierr); CHKERRQ(ierr)
! top face has 3 edges
call DMPlexSetCone(dm, 2, [12,13,14], ierr); CHKERRQ(ierr)
! side faces have 4 edges
call DMPlexSetCone(dm, 3, [ 7, 9,11,13],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 4, [ 6, 9,10,12],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 5, [ 8,10,11,14], ierr); CHKERRQ(ierr)
! and the corresponding vertices
call DMPlexSetCone(dm, 6, [15,16],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 7, [15,17],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 8, [16,17],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 9, [15,18],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 10, [16,19],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 11, [17,20],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 12, [18,19],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 13, [18,20], ierr); CHKERRQ(ierr)
call DMPlexSetCone(dm, 14, [19,20], ierr); CHKERRQ(ierr)
call DMPlexSymmetrize(dm, ierr); CHKERRQ(ierr)
call DMPlexStratify(dm, ierr); CHKERRQ(ierr)
call set_coords()
end subroutine
subroutine set_coords()
PetscScalar, pointer :: coords(:)
Vec :: coordinates
PetscInt :: dimEmbed, coordSize, vStart, vEnd, pStart, pEnd, voff
PetscSection :: coordSection
call DMGetCoordinateDim(dm, dimEmbed, ierr); CHKERRQ(ierr)
call DMGetCoordinateSection(dm, coordSection, ierr); CHKERRQ(ierr)
call PetscSectionSetNumFields(coordSection, 1, ierr); CHKERRQ(ierr)
call PetscSectionSetUp(coordSection, ierr); CHKERRQ(ierr)
call PetscSectionSetFieldComponents(coordSection, 0, dimEmbed, ierr); CHKERRQ(ierr)
call DMPlexGetChart(dm, pStart, pEnd, ierr); CHKERRQ(ierr)
call DMPlexGetDepthStratum (dm, 0, vStart, vEnd, ierr); CHKERRQ(ierr) ! vertices
call PetscSectionSetChart(coordSection, pStart, pEnd, ierr);CHKERRQ(ierr)
do i = vStart, vEnd-1
call PetscSectionSetDof(coordSection, i, dimEmbed, ierr); CHKERRQ(ierr)
call PetscSectionSetFieldDof(coordSection, i, 0, dimEmbed, ierr); CHKERRQ(ierr)
enddo
call PetscSectionSetUp(coordSection, ierr); CHKERRQ(ierr)
call PetscSectionGetStorageSize(coordSection, coordSize, ierr); CHKERRQ(ierr)
call VecCreate(PETSC_COMM_SELF, coordinates, ierr); CHKERRQ(ierr)
call VecSetSizes(coordinates, coordSize, PETSC_DETERMINE, ierr);CHKERRQ(ierr)
call VecSetBlockSize(coordinates, dimEmbed, ierr);CHKERRQ(ierr)
call VecSetType(coordinates, VECSTANDARD, ierr);CHKERRQ(ierr)
call PetscObjectSetName(coordinates, "coordinates", ierr); CHKERRQ(ierr)
call VecGetArrayF90(coordinates, coords, ierr); CHKERRQ(ierr)
i = 15; call PetscSectionGetOffset(coordSection, i, voff, ierr); coords(voff+1:voff+3) = [0,0,0]
i = 16; call PetscSectionGetOffset(coordSection, i, voff, ierr); coords(voff+1:voff+3) = [0,2,0]
i = 17; call PetscSectionGetOffset(coordSection, i, voff, ierr); coords(voff+1:voff+3) = [2,1,0]
i = 18; call PetscSectionGetOffset(coordSection, i, voff, ierr); coords(voff+1:voff+3) = [0,0,1]
i = 19; call PetscSectionGetOffset(coordSection, i, voff, ierr); coords(voff+1:voff+3) = [0,2,1]
i = 20; call PetscSectionGetOffset(coordSection, i, voff, ierr); coords(voff+1:voff+3) = [2,1,1]
call VecRestoreArrayF90(coordinates, coords, ierr); CHKERRQ(ierr)
call DMSetCoordinatesLocal(dm, coordinates, ierr);CHKERRQ(ierr)
call PetscObjectViewFromOptions(coordinates, PETSC_NULL_VEC, "-show_plex_coordinates", ierr); CHKERRQ(ierr)
call VecDestroy(coordinates, ierr);CHKERRQ(ierr)
end subroutine
end program
